My loader manual says grease every 10 hours. I generally grease once a month.
As long as you clock in 10 hours per month, you're good.

Remember the bouncing across a field = loader work hours = Pin Wear. Those pins are under pressure as you drive and bounce around. There's no cushioning, so if it's metal on metal, there will be wear.

Lock and lube tip was a real game changer especially for the zerks in hard to reach places. I keep a grease rag near the grease gun to wipe off the zerks before greasing and to clean up if I get too enthusiastic.
